Добавить в корзинуПозвонить
Найти в Дзене
Уроки Linux

📡 Как быстро поднять свой собственный репозиторий Docker для автоматизации разработки

📡 Как быстро поднять свой собственный репозиторий Docker для автоматизации разработки Привет, любители технологий! 🚀 Хотите избавиться от беспорядка в проекте и легко делиться приложениями? Создание собственного Docker-репозитория — отличный способ систематизировать свои образы и ускорить работу! Сегодня расскажу, как устроить минимальный, но мощный локальный репозиторий прямо у себя дома. Самое важное тут — безопасность и удобство: вы сами контролируете доступ и делаете быстрый пуш и пул образов. Плюсы такого подхода: - Быстрый обмен образами без лишних сторонних сервисов - Полный контроль над хранилищем - Улучшение навыков работы с Docker Registry Для начала нужно просто запустить публичный реестр: docker run -d -p 5000:5000 --restart=always --name registry registry:2 Теперь у вас есть свой мини-склад! Можно пушить туда образы: docker tag myapp localhost:5000/myapp docker push localhost:5000/myapp И при необходимости — подтягивать: docker pull localhost:5000/myapp Всего за

📡 Как быстро поднять свой собственный репозиторий Docker для автоматизации разработки

Привет, любители технологий! 🚀 Хотите избавиться от беспорядка в проекте и легко делиться приложениями? Создание собственного Docker-репозитория — отличный способ систематизировать свои образы и ускорить работу! Сегодня расскажу, как устроить минимальный, но мощный локальный репозиторий прямо у себя дома.

Самое важное тут — безопасность и удобство: вы сами контролируете доступ и делаете быстрый пуш и пул образов.

Плюсы такого подхода:

- Быстрый обмен образами без лишних сторонних сервисов

- Полный контроль над хранилищем

- Улучшение навыков работы с Docker Registry

Для начала нужно просто запустить публичный реестр:

docker run -d -p 5000:5000 --restart=always --name registry registry:2

Теперь у вас есть свой мини-склад! Можно пушить туда образы:

docker tag myapp localhost:5000/myapp

docker push localhost:5000/myapp

И при необходимости — подтягивать:

docker pull localhost:5000/myapp

Всего за пару команд вы превращаете свой ПК в полноценный Docker Registry, который работает как часовой! Имеет смысл — ведь это не только удобно, но и помогает понять внутреннюю кухню Docker и процессы CI/CD.

Рассматриваешь ли ты возможность перейти на самостоятельный репозиторий? А может, уже практиковал?

Прокачай свои скилы в телеграм канале https://t.me/LinuxSkill а пройти тесты на знание linux в боте https://t.me/gradeliftbot